/* BASICS */ body { text-align: center; color: #000; margin: 0; border: 0; padding: 0; background: url(../img_communes/fd.gif) no-repeat center top; /* marron #E9E2D4 rouge #8C0202 gris1 #8E8E86 gris2 #DDDDDA gris3 #B5B5B0 */ } form { margin: 0; padding: 0; border: 0px solid #FFF; } body, select, td, input, div, textarea{ font: 11px Verdana, Times New Roman, Times, serif; } input, textarea { background: #FFF; color: #000; border: 1px solid #000; padding-left: 2px; } .radio { background: none; border: 0; } .bouton{ background:url(../img_communes/fd_bouton.gif); border-color:000; color:#535458; font-weight: normal; border: 0px; } h2{ font: 11px Verdana, Times New Roman, Times, serif; font-weight: bold; color: #000; margin: 0 0 0 0px; height: 16px; } h3 { font: 11px Verdana, Times New Roman, Times, serif; font-weight: normal; color: #535458; padding: 0 0 0 9px; background: url(../img_communes/puce.gif) no-repeat left center; margin:0px; } .ttpTitre{ font: 11px Verdana, Times New Roman, Times, serif; font-weight: bold; color: #535458; padding: 0 0 0 7px; background: url(../img_communes/puce.gif) no-repeat left center; margin:0px; } a:link, a:visited, a:active { text-decoration: none; color: #DA6D08; } a:hover { text-decoration: none; color: #000; } a.rouge:link, a.rouge:visited, a.rouge:active{ color: #8C0202; } a.rouge:hover { color:#000; } a.noir:link, a.noir:visited, a.noir:active{ color: #000; } a.noir:hover { color:#8C0202; } a.page:link, a.page:visited, a.page:active{ font-weight: bold; text-align: center; overflow: hidden; width: 15px; color: #FFF; background: #8E8E86; } a.page:hover, .pageOn, a.pageOn, a.pageOn:link, a.pageOn:visited, a.pageOn:active { font-weight: bold; text-align: center; overflow: hidden; width: 15px; color: #FFF; background: #8C0202; } .pageNo { font-weight: bold; text-align: center; overflow: hidden; width: 15px; color: #FFF; background: #DDDDDD; } .puce, a.puce:link, a.puce:visited, a.puce:active{ font-weight: bold; color: #8C0202; padding-left: 13px; background: url(../img_communes/puce_b.gif) no-repeat left center; } a.puce:hover { color:#000; } a.consultez:link, a.consultez:visited, a.consultez:active{ color: #000; } a.consultez:hover { color: #FF8401; } a.lezart:link, a.lezart:visited, a.lezart:active{ color: #ACDABF; font-weight:normal; } a.lezart:hover { color:#000; } a.pdf, a.pdf:link, a.pdf:hover, a.pdf:visited, a.pdf:active{ padding-top: 4px; padding-left: 20px; height: 16px; font-weight: bold; background: url(../img_communes/pdf.gif) left top no-repeat; } .retour { display: block; overflow: hidden; width: 100%; height: 12px; text-align: right; z-index: 0; margin-bottom: 2px; } .retour a, .retour a:visited, .retour a:link { display: block; overflow: hidden; margin-top: 0; } .retour a:hover{ margin-top: -12px; } .retourHaut { display: block; overflow:hidden; margin: 0 auto; width: 100%; height: 13px; text-align: center; z-index:0; margin-top:5px; margin-bottom:5px; } .retourHaut a, .retourHaut a:visited, .retourHaut a:link { margin-top:-13px; } .retourHaut a:hover{ margin-top:0; } #formSlide { display: none; } /*les elements*/ #container { display: block; width: 780px; height: 100%; margin: 0 auto; text-align: left; } #Haut { position:absolute; display: block; overflow: hidden; height: 152px; float: left; } #navH { position:absolute; display: none; float: left; top: 190px; margin-left: 23px; width: 188px; } #navH img{ border: 0; display: block; overflow: hidden; } #navH span{ display: block; overflow:hidden; height: 26px; padding: 0; } #navH a, #navH a:visited, #navH a:link { display: block; overflow: hidden; cursor:hand; } #navH span a:hover { margin-top : -26px; } #navH .navOn a, #navH .navOn a:visited, #navH .navOn a:link { margin-top : -26px; } a.ssNavOff, a.ssNavOff:link, a.ssNavOff:visited { color: #000; padding-left: 10px; } a.ssNavOff:hover { color: #006736; padding-left: 10px; } .ssNavOn{ color: #006736; padding-left: 10px; } #imgArbre{ position:absolute; display: block; overflow: hidden; margin-left: 225px; top: 208px; height: 27px; width: 539px; z-index=2; } #imghaute{ position: absolute; display: block; overflow: hidden; margin-left: 225px; top: 110px; height: 130px; width: 539px; float: left; } #contenu{ position: absolute; display: block; overflow: hidden; margin-left: 230px; top: 260px; width: 530px; height: auto; } #bas { width: 530px; display: block; overflow: hidden; color: #ACDABF; font: 11px Verdana, Times New Roman, Times, serif; } #formRecherche { padding-top: 10px; } #recherche { width: 100px; height: 20px; border: 2px solid #9FB6CF; } #btSubmit { color: #FFF; font-weight: bold; width: 20px; height: 20px; background: #9FB6CF; border: 2px solid #9FB6CF; } hr { padding: 0; margin: 5px 0 5px 0; height: 1px; } .clear { clear: both; height: 0px; padding: 0; margin: 0; font: 0; visibility: hidden; } .imgRight { float: right; margin-left: 5px; } .imgLeft { float: left; margin-right: 5px; } .imgRightR { text-align: center; padding-left: 5px; } .imgLeftL { text-align: center; padding-right: 5px; } .imgTop { text-align: center; padding-bottom: 7px; } .imgBottom { text-align: center; padding-top: 7px; } #imgzoom { display: none; POSITION: absolute; text-align: center; padding: 0; color: #000; width: 537px; height: auto; OVERFLOW:hidden; background: #FFF; border: 0px solid #8C0202; cursor:hand; z-index: 2000; } #imgzoom p{ padding: 1px; } #imgzoom a{ color: #000; font-weight: bold; } .ttpTexte { display: block; overflow: hidden; width: auto; height: auto; margin: 0; text-align: left; } .titreGris { overflow: hidden; display: block; width: auto; text-align: left; margin: 0px 0 7px 0; } .titreGris span { color: #535456; font-weight: bold; padding: 0 5px 0 5px; } .ttpTitre2 { width: auto; height: 25px; padding-right: 20px; background: url(../img_communes/fond_titre_rouge.gif) no-repeat bottom right; } .ttpTexte p, .ttpTexte td, .ttpTexte li { color: #000; font: 11px Verdana, Times New Roman, Times, serif; } .ttpTexte h2{ font: 11px Verdana, Times New Roman, Times, serif; font-weight: bold; padding-left: 20px; margin: 0 0 0 0px; height: 16px; } .ttpTexte .date{ font-style: italic; padding: 0; margin: 0; } .ttpTexte2 { display: block; width: 100%; overflow: hidden; padding: 5px 0 5px 0; width: 265px; border: 1px solid #9DADE2; }